Sorry if I'm being obtuse - is there a reason for the question? If it's just semantics, I'm not sure it really matters too much. If it becomes game related through some kind of mechanic, I would probably suggest being very clear about what you mean when explaining the game's mechanics.

If a player reaches endgame and cannot achieve a win condition, it doesn't really matter whether they're alive or not, I don't think... they've lost.


With respect to mafia wincons, they vary across games for balance reasons. It usually depends on mod preference + mechanics + setup really.

For example in a nightless game, if the mafia'a win condition is "kill all townies or have nothing be able to stop this", is 3:3 a win? or a stalemate? in a game with a vigilante, too, having a win condition of parity is a pretty important balancing factor.

there's a fair bit to consider on that front. but let me know what your angle is with the endgamed = dead question if you want a second opinion.
